云數據庫PostgreSQL的成本因多種因素而異,包括選擇的云服務提供商、實例規格、使用量以及是否需要額外的功能或支持等。以下是對云數據庫PostgreSQL成本及影響因素的詳細分析:
云數據庫PostgreSQL成本構成
- 軟件許可費用:PostgreSQL是開源的,因此軟件許可費用為零。
- 云服務費用:包括計算資源(CPU、內存)、存儲空間(SSD或HDD)、網絡帶寬等。
- 運維成本:包括系統維護、備份、恢復、安全加固等。
- 支持和維護費用:取決于選擇的云服務提供商,一些提供商提供額外的技術支持和維護服務。
影響云數據庫PostgreSQL成本的因素
- 實例規格:更高的CPU、內存和存儲規格會導致更高的費用。
- 使用量:根據實際使用的計算資源和存儲空間計費,使用量越多,費用越高。
- 地區:不同地區的定價可能有所不同,通常偏遠地區的費用較低。
- 折扣和優惠:長期訂閱或預付費模式可能會提供折扣。
降低云數據庫PostgreSQL成本的策略
- 選擇合適的云服務提供商:比較不同提供商的價格和服務質量,選擇性價比最高的選項。
- 優化實例規格:根據實際使用需求調整實例規格,避免資源浪費。
- 利用折扣和優惠:利用預付費模式或長期訂閱獲取折扣。
- 監控和優化使用:定期監控資源使用情況,優化查詢和索引,減少不必要的資源消耗。
云數據庫PostgreSQL與其他數據庫的成本比較
- PostgreSQL與Oracle:PostgreSQL是開源的,成本較低,沒有許可費用,而Oracle是商業數據庫,需要支付昂貴的許可費用和維護成本。
- PostgreSQL與MySQL:兩者都是開源數據庫,但PostgreSQL通常提供更高的性能和更豐富的功能,成本相對較低。
綜上所述,云數據庫PostgreSQL的成本因多種因素而異,選擇合適的云服務提供商、優化實例規格和利用折扣及優惠是降低成本的策略。同時,與其他數據庫相比,PostgreSQL在成本控制方面具有明顯優勢。